Meeting Point and Accessibility
The gathering spot is straightforward: “Nos vemos en unas tarimas de madera en el Paseo de Las Cucharas, justo enfrente de la heladería Antiu Xixona.” It’s easy to find, right on the promenade, and the area tends to be lively but relaxed. Whether you’re staying nearby or coming from further afield, the location is central and convenient.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need prior yoga experience? No, the class is suitable for all levels, including complete beginners.
What should I bring? Bring sunscreen, water, and comfortable clothes. You can bring your own yoga mat or use one provided by the instructor.
Where exactly do I meet? The meeting point is on wooden platforms at Paseo de Las Cucharas, opposite the Antiu Xixona ice cream shop.
Is the class conducted in English? Yes, it is conducted in both Spanish and English, making it accessible for international travelers.
What if the weather is bad? The experience is outdoors, so if weather conditions are poor, such as rain or strong wind, it might be postponed or canceled. Check the forecast before booking.
How long is the class? The session lasts approximately 1 hour, with varying start times depending on availability.
